What is Wordle?

A viral word game that has taken the social media world by storm. Wordle is a daily word puzzle that gives you a five-letter word to guess. There are no hints. You get a new game each day and 5 tries to get it right. 

Here’s How it Works:

You can find the daily word puzzle online and play it every day. 

You get 5 attempts at figuring out the word. You start by guessing a five-letter word. The puzzle will then show you if your letters are in the word or the correct spot. 

If your letter is greyed out, it means that the letter is not in today’s word. If it’s yellow, it means the letter is in the word, but you guessed it in the wrong spot. Green means the letter is in the target word and in the correct place. 

Wordle Tips: 

Many people like to use a five-letter word with vowels for the first word to get a good head start. You can use words like Adieu and Audio.

Improve Cognitive Function

Stress can sometimes cause mental fatigue. If you feel like your brain needs a workout, try playing Wordle. Any type of cognitive activity, from crosswords to chess, has been shown to have some brain-boosting benefits. 

Playing word games, in particular, may give your noggin a perfect workout. They typically involve multiple skills—like word association, memory recall, and puzzle-solving—that engage different parts of the brain. As a result, playing Wordle can help to keep your mind sharp and agile.
